Which Materials Are Best for Comfort and Durability?

The best materials for comfort and durability in wide fit boots for men include the following:

  • Full-grain leather: This is one of the most durable materials available for boots, known for its toughness and ability to develop a rich patina over time. Full-grain leather is also breathable and molds to the shape of your foot, providing excellent comfort with each wear.
  • Suede: While not as tough as full-grain leather, suede offers a softer texture and a unique aesthetic appeal. Suede provides a good level of comfort and can be treated for water resistance, making it suitable for a variety of casual and semi-formal settings.
  • Nubuck leather: Similar to suede but made from the outer layer of the hide, nubuck has a fine, velvety texture and is renowned for its durability and comfort. It is also more resistant to wear and tear than regular suede, making it a great choice for daily wear.
  • Synthetic materials: Options like nylon or polyester blends can provide exceptional durability while being lightweight and water-resistant. These materials often come with additional padding or insulation, enhancing comfort, particularly for those needing extra room in wide fit boots.
  • Rubber soles: While not a material for the upper part of the boot, rubber soles are crucial for comfort and durability. They provide excellent traction and shock absorption, making them ideal for various terrains while ensuring a longer lifespan for the boots.
  • Memory foam insoles: While not a boot material per se, memory foam insoles enhance comfort significantly by conforming to the shape of the foot. They help reduce pressure points and improve overall fit, especially in wide fit styles, making them a valuable addition for long-term wear.

What Are the Most Popular Styles of Wide Fit Boots for Men?

The most popular styles of wide fit boots for men include:

  • Chukka Boots: Chukka boots are ankle-high and typically feature two or three eyelets. Their versatile design makes them suitable for both casual and semi-formal occasions, and wide fit options provide comfort for those with broader feet.
  • Work Boots: Work boots are designed for durability and support, often featuring steel toes and slip-resistant soles. Wide fit work boots are essential for those who spend long hours on their feet, ensuring both safety and comfort in demanding environments.
  • Desert Boots: Desert boots are made from suede or leather and have a crepe rubber sole, offering a lightweight and breathable option. The wide fit variant allows for better circulation and comfort, making them perfect for casual outings or travel.
  • Hiking Boots: Hiking boots are built for rugged terrain, featuring reinforced soles and weather-resistant materials. Wide fit hiking boots provide the necessary support and stability, accommodating foot swelling during long hikes.
  • Chelsea Boots: Chelsea boots are characterized by their elastic side panels and sleek design, making them a stylish choice for any wardrobe. A wide fit version ensures that the ankle-hugging style remains comfortable without compromising on style.
  • Combat Boots: Combat boots are designed for durability and protection, often featuring a lace-up front and thick soles. Wide fit combat boots allow for a relaxed fit while providing the necessary support for all-day wear in various environments.

How Can I Properly Care for My Wide Fit Boots to Ensure Longevity?

Proper care for your wide fit boots can significantly extend their lifespan and maintain their appearance.

  • Regular Cleaning: Keeping your boots clean is essential for maintaining their quality.
  • Conditioning the Leather: Leather boots require conditioning to prevent drying out and cracking.
  • Proper Storage: Storing your boots correctly can prevent deformity and damage.
  • Waterproofing: Applying a waterproofing treatment can protect your boots from moisture.
  • Using Boot Trees: Boot trees help maintain the shape of your boots while not in use.

Regular cleaning involves removing dirt and grime after each use, which can be done with a soft brush or damp cloth. For deeper cleaning, you may need to use specialized leather cleaners, ensuring that you follow the manufacturer’s instructions to avoid damaging the material.

Conditioning the leather is crucial as it helps to keep the material supple and prevents it from becoming brittle. Use a high-quality leather conditioner and apply it evenly, allowing it to soak in before buffing off any excess to maintain a polished look.

Proper storage means placing your boots in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ight, which can fade colors and weaken materials. Consider using dust bags or boxes to protect your boots from dust and scratches when not in use.

Waterproofing your boots, especially if they’re made from leather, is essential for protecting against rain or spills. Use a waterproof spray or wax, and reapply it regularly, especially after cleaning, to ensure a barrier against moisture.

Using boot trees is an effective way to keep your boots in shape, preventing creasing and maintaining their structure. Choose wooden boot trees, as they can absorb moisture and odors, keeping your boots fresh and extended in longevity.
